SAIL Achieves ‘Great Place to Work’ Certification for Third Time

New Delhi: Steel Authority of India Limited (SAIL), India’s largest public sector steelmaker and a Maharatna company, has secured the prestigious ‘Great Place to Work’ certification for February 2026 to February 2027, marking the third consecutive year of recognition. The certification, awarded by the Great Place To Work Institute, India, highlights SAIL’s sustained commitment to fostering a contemporary, agile, and employee-focused workplace culture.

Employee Trust and Workplace Culture

SAIL’s achievement comes on the back of a notable increase in its TRUST INDEX © score, which measures the percentage of employees providing positive feedback during the Institute’s company-wide assessment. The rigorous evaluation by the Great Place To Work Institute recognizes organizations delivering exceptional employee experiences through transparency, fairness, and professional growth opportunities.

Progressive HR Initiatives

SAIL has implemented several forward-looking HR initiatives aimed at empowering employees and aligning performance with organizational goals. Key among these is SAIL DARPAN, a platform promoting transparent, performance-driven evaluation and target-setting. Employees are encouraged to own their growth while contributing meaningfully to the company’s objectives.

Additionally, SAIL provides domain-change opportunities for executives through specialized training programs in collaboration with premier institutes like IIM Kozhikode, Bangalore, Jammu, Raipur, Ranchi, XLRI, and ASCI. These programs focus on marketing, human resources, and other management domains, enabling employees to expand skill sets and career trajectories.
